%X Typical damages to reinforced concrete school buildings during the 2011 East Japan earthquake were reviewed. Procedures and causes of the damages are estimated as the specific responses to the ground motions at site with the spectral intensity of the ground motions recorded nearby. The lessons derived from the damages are discussed on peculiar design or general design requirements.<p /> <p>Language: en</p>
